Vax W85-PP-T Specification

The Vax W85-PP-T is a high-performance carpet washer designed to deliver efficient deep cleaning for carpets and upholstery. Powered by a robust 800-watt motor, it ensures superior suction capabilities, effectively lifting embedded dirt and debris. The washer features dual rotating brush bars that agitate carpet fibers, ensuring thorough cleaning by loosening and lifting dirt from deep within the pile. It is equipped with a large clean water tank capacity of 3.5 liters and a separate dirty water tank, which facilitates extended cleaning sessions without frequent interruptions for refilling and emptying.

The Vax W85-PP-T incorporates a quick-drying system that minimizes carpet drying time post-cleaning, making it convenient for busy households. Its user-friendly design includes an easy-to-use trigger mechanism that releases the cleaning solution precisely where needed, optimizing detergent usage. The machine comes with a specialized wash tool for targeted spot cleaning on stairs and upholstery, enhancing its versatility.

Ergonomically designed, the washer features a lightweight build and a comfortable handle, promoting ease of maneuverability across various surfaces. The Vax W85-PP-T includes a generous 9-meter power cord, providing ample reach to cover large rooms without the need to switch power outlets frequently. Its maintenance is straightforward, with removable tanks and brushes that allow for easy cleaning and storage.

Vax W85-PP-T F.A.Q.

How do I assemble the Vax W85-PP-T carpet cleaner?

To assemble the Vax W85-PP-T, attach the handle to the base unit by aligning it with the slot and securing it with the provided screws. Ensure all parts are firmly connected before use.

What is the best way to clean the water tank?

Empty the water tank after each use. Rinse it with warm water and mild detergent. Make sure to remove any residual water before reattaching.

Why is the suction power weak on my Vax W85-PP-T?

Check if the water tank or dirt container is full. Ensure all filters are clean and the nozzle is free from blockages. Tighten all connections to improve suction.

How often should I replace the filters?

For optimal performance, replace the filters every 6 months or as needed, depending on frequency of use. Regular cleaning of filters can extend their lifespan.

What solution should I use with the Vax W85-PP-T?

Use only Vax-approved carpet cleaning solutions to ensure compatibility and optimal cleaning results. Avoid using bleach or other harsh chemicals.

How do I troubleshoot if the machine doesn't turn on?

Check the power cord for any damage and ensure it is plugged into a working outlet. Test the outlet with another device to confirm. If the problem persists, consult the user manual for further troubleshooting steps.

Can I use the Vax W85-PP-T on hard floors?

The Vax W85-PP-T is designed primarily for carpets. Using it on hard floors is not recommended as it may not perform effectively and could risk damage.

What should I do if the machine leaks water?

First, ensure that all tanks are correctly attached and not overfilled. Check seals for any damage and replace if necessary. Tighten connections and refer to the manual if the issue continues.

How do I store the Vax W85-PP-T after use?

Ensure the machine is cleaned and dried completely before storage. Store it in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and ensure the power cord is neatly wrapped.

Is it normal for the machine to make loud noises?

Some noise is normal, but excessive noise might indicate a blockage or loose part. Check for obstructions and ensure parts are securely attached. Refer to the manual if the noise persists.
